What is the difference between a SYMBOLIC CEREMONY & a CIVIL CEREMONY?
The Symbolic Ceremony, which all of our Wedding Romance Packages include, is a ceremony that does not "legally bind" the couple and is performed by a Non-Denominational Minister. This ceremony is a beautiful allowing for the exchange of vows & rings. The Civil Ceremony gives you the "Marriage Certificate" with legally binds the bride & groom. This Civil Ceremony has an additional price to our Romance Packages and requires that you be in the country in which you are to be married a minimum of 3 full business days. The Symbolic Ceremony allows the couple to get "legally" married in their hometown, before or after their stay at our Resort, without the worries of rushing to obtain all of the legal requirements needed to get married in a foreign country (i.e. paperwork, translations, apostille seal, medical certificates, blood work, etc.).

Will my Marriage Certificate be valid in the USA & Canada?
Foreign marriage certificates from Costa Rica, Dominican Republic & Mexico are recognized in the USA & Canada, expect to receive your marriage certificate no later than 120 days after your civil ceremony.
